Job Description

Large, integrated and well-established group in the agriculture sector is looking to employ a Cost Accountant. This group has interests across the country and this role will be situated in Stellenbosch, Western Cape.

The ideal candidate will have cost accounting experience, and within Agriculture, Farming, Export, Manufacturing, Processing, or similar, an advantage. For more junior candidates, on the job training and guidance will be provided. Tertiary and professional qualifications will be an added benefit but not required if the candidate has the desired experience.

This role will suit someone that is keen to learn, develop their skills, and is willing to help out where needed. This is also a great opportunity for personal growth, in earnings, as well as growth within this fast expanding business.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Calculate and analyze Gross Profit (GP) per product, variety, market, and customer.
  • Monitor and report cost of sales and cost per unit across different export channels.
  • Assist and update costing models.
  • Perform variance analysis between actual and budgeted costs.
  • Track and report logistics costs.
  • Prepare monthly cost reports and dashboards for management.
  • Maintain costing records for traceability and regulatory purposes.
  • Work with ERP systems (ProduceLink, Business Central, Navision, etc.).
  • Perform cost calculations and input into the system.
  • Identify and implement efficiency improvements in cost tracking and reporting.
  • Assist in seasonal cost planning and budgeting.
  • Ensure compliance with local and international accounting standards.
  • Liaise with procurement, logistics, finance, and operations teams.
  • Support forecasting and planning activities with accurate cost data.
  • Participate in weekly planning meetings to align costing with operational goals.
  • Ad hoc financial assistance and admin as required.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Matric and Costing / Cost Accounting experience.
  • Degree, Diploma, or Certificate in Cost Accounting, Management Accounting, Accounting, or similar.
  • 3+ years relatable experience.
  • ProduceLink, Business Central, Navision, or related ERP experience advantageous.
  • Practical or theoretical Cost Accounting knowledge or experience.
  • MS Excel proficiency.

Remuneration:

  • R300,000 to R480,000 per annum cost to company, depending on experience.
